**Team & Job Overview**:
Join the **Digital & Technology Solutions (DTS)** group at Export Development Canada (EDC), established in 2023 to deliver secure and reliable digital experiences. Our mission is to empower customers and colleagues to take on the world by achieving EDC’s 2030 business transformation goals.

**Key Objectives**:

- Define and sustain the integrated technology target state, data model, and technology operations.
- Manage the 3-Year Digital Roadmap.
- Keep pace with industry trends and emerging technologies.
- Lead and ensure integrated digital, data, infrastructure, and cybersecurity implementations to create excellent customer, user, and employee experiences.

**Role Overview**:
The **Enterprise Information Security (EIS)** team is seeking a **Cybersecurity Program Manager** to lead and manage a portfolio of cybersecurity projects. Reporting to the EIS Director, you will support strategic planning, outline tactics, and manage resources to achieve EDC's business goals.

**Key Responsibilities**:

- Plan, manage, track, and execute a portfolio of cybersecurity projects.
- Collaborate with technical and non-technical partners to design, plan, and report on cybersecurity initiatives.
- Maintain open communication with business and technology units.
- Act as the primary contact for cyber governance and issue resolution.
- Optimize resource utilization and project planning.
- Foster innovation and continuous improvement, in collaboration with relevant partners.

**Screening Criteria**:

- Undergraduate degree in Computer Science, Information Security, Management Information Systems or related field.
- Minimum 5 years of hands-on project/program management experience in business analyst, scrum master, product owner management and product development.
- Minimum 3 years leading cybersecurity or technology project implementations.
- Minimum 2 years’ experience implementing technology programs, influencing and driving cross-functional teams to deliver solutions in complex, dynamic environments.
- Excellent communication, strategic thinking, and time management skills.
- Experience managing service providers/vendors.

**Assets**:

- Knowledge of security frameworks (NIST, ISO, COBIT, CIS).
- Relevant certifications (Scrum Alliance, SAFe, PMP, CISM, GIAC).
- Bilingual in English and French.

**Compensation**:

- Salary range: $92,355 to $123,140 annually, plus performance-based incentive.

**Location**:

- Hybrid work environment.
- Role based in Ottawa or from Community Hubs in Toronto, Mississauga, Montreal, Laval, Brossard, Halifax, Calgary, or Vancouver.
- Relocation assistance available
